Concept of Transportation

Transportation is the movement of goods or passengers from one place to another. It’s a crucial industry, playing a vital role in the socio-economic development of any nation. The efficiency of the transportation sector directly impacts production costs, business competitiveness, and the quality of life for citizens.

Types of Transportation

1. Road Transportation:

Advantages: Flexible, high accessibility, relatively low transportation costs for short distances. Disadvantages: Time-consuming, susceptible to weather conditions, traffic congestion.

2. Rail Transportation:

Advantages: High volume capacity, cost-effective for long distances, safer than road transport. Disadvantages: Less flexible, limited accessibility, potentially longer transit times.

3. Water Transportation:

Advantages: High volume capacity at low cost, suitable for bulky goods. Disadvantages: Slow transit times, dependent on weather and hydrological conditions.

4. Air Transportation:

Advantages: Fastest mode of transport, suitable for urgent goods. Disadvantages: High cost, limitations on weight and size of goods.

5. Intermodal Transportation:

Combines multiple modes of transport to optimize the shipping process, for example, transporting goods by container from a seaport to a warehouse by rail, then distributing to final destinations by truck. This is a rapidly growing trend.

Future Trends in Transportation

1. Digitalization and Automation: Utilizing information technology, artificial intelligence, and the Internet of Things (IoT) to optimize operational processes, management, and tracking of goods and vehicles. Examples include smart warehouse management systems, self-driving vehicles, and GPS tracking.

2. Sustainable Transportation: Focusing on minimizing environmental impact through the use of clean fuels, eco-friendly vehicles, and optimized transportation routes.

3. Integrated Logistics: Integrating various logistics activities such as warehousing, packaging, transportation, and delivery to create an efficient and seamless supply chain.

4. The Rise of E-commerce: The rapid growth of e-commerce has fueled the demand for fast, efficient, and secure transportation services, particularly for small parcel deliveries.

The transportation industry is constantly evolving and innovating to meet the ever-increasing demands of society. The combination of modern technology and government support policies will contribute to the sustainable development of this industry in the future.
